Profitability in agriculture: Keeping Control over Chemical Usage
Tom Fannon shares his experience with managing the cost and consumption of chemical products on the farm; to keep both compliant and profitable. Tom Fannon is the Owner and Manager at Fannon Agriculture, a 38-hectare apple and pear farm near Maidstone, Kent, UK. He didn’t grow up in a farming family or have an operation […]
